About This Position
Job Description: The senior technical accountant prepares consolidated and individual financial and business related accounting reports and analyses in areas such as revenue, operating expenses, depreciation, investment, equity earnings and income taxes. Responsibilities include preparing and analyzing consolidated and individual ten-year business plans and forecasts, providing general ledger support through the completion of journal entries, posting and reconciling general ledger, purchasing, inventory and accounts payable transactions, preparing supporting documentation and assisting in the development of accounting policies and procedures.
Responsibilities: Prepare and analyze consolidated and individual financial statements including income statement, balance sheet and cash flow statement, forecasts and variance analyses for various renewables projects as assigned. (20%) Complete journal entries, including the transfer and posting of accounts payable and inventory transactions. Verify and prepare supporting documentation associated with journal entry preparation. Maintain general ledger detail and complete monthly reconciliations of numerous accounts and activities. (20%) Provide technical input by assisting and analyzing the development of the business plans and other financial models. (10%) Coordinate and help facilitate the year-end audits. (10%) Assist with researching, analyzing and interpreting accounting pronouncements and assist in the evaluation of their impact and financial reporting for management. (10%) Prepare consolidation of BHE Renewables Consolidated, BHE Wind and BHE Solar projects in Hyperion. (5%) Perform maintenance of the GL module within Oracle by adding new accounts, codeblock, and validation rules and updating and running Oracle reports as necessary. (5%) Present results of research and analyses and provide recommendations in written and verbal presentation formats. (5%) Use personal computer-based systems and software to compile and prepare reports, graphs and charts of data developed to include in presentations. (5%) Work on special projects and develop appropriate financial models as necessary. (5%) Perform additional responsibilities as requested or assigned. (5%)
Qualifications: Bachelor's degree in accounting. MBA and CPA preferred. Six or more years work experience in accounting with emphasis in financial or regulatory reporting and financial analysis. Accounting/finance skills to apply generally accepted accounting principles in preparing financial statements and reports. Effective analytical and problem-solving skills. Personal computer skills; proficiency in Word, Excel, Access, and PowerPoint; some experience with related financial software, demonstrated ability to understand and utilize computer systems. Leadership abilities, effective interpersonal skills and the ability to work independently and as part of a team. Effective oral and written communication skills. Ability to prioritize and handle multiple tasks and projects concurrently.
